Abstract: 3-Acetylcoumarin (1) was utilized as a key intermediate for the synthesis of 2-aminothiazole derivative 3 via bromination of 1 to afford acetylbromide 2 followed by treatment with thiourea or via Biginelli reaction of 1. Treatment of 3 with 5-chloro-3-methyl-1-phenyl-1H-pyrazole-4-carbaldehyde, 2-methyl-4H-benzo[d][1,3]oxazin-4-one, furo[3,4-b]pyrazine-5,7-dione or 2-methyl-5,6,7,8-tetrahydro-4H-benzothieno[2,3-d][1,3]oxazin-4-one afforded diazine derivatives 4-7. Also, pyridopyrimidine 8 was obtained via a one pot reaction of 6-aminothiouracil, p-chlorobenzaldehyde and 3-acetylcoumarin. Moreover, refluxing of 6-aminothiouracil with one equivalent amount of 2 afforded the thiazolopyrimidine 9, while the pyrrolothiazolopyrimidine 10 was revealed when two equivalent amounts of 2 was used. Furthermore, treatment of enamine 11 with 2-aminobenzothiazole or 6-aminothiouracil afforded the pyrimidine derivatives 12 and 13, respectively. Transamination of enamine 11 with m-anisidine followed by cyclization of the resulting enaminone 14 gave the desired quinoline 15. Also, treatment of 11 with thiophenol in dioxane gave the mercapto derivative 16. Moreover, coupling of 11 with 4,6-dimethyl-1H-pyrazolo[3,4-b]pyridin-3-yl-diazonium chloride, followed by complete cyclization of the resulting product afforded the pyridopyrazolothiazine 19 via the intermediate 18. Furthermore, the pyrazolopyrimidine 20 was revealed via a one pot condensation of 11, 3-methyl-1-phenyl-1H-pyrazol-5(4H)-one and ammonium acetate. The thiadiazine derivatives 21-23 were obtained via treatment of 2 with the corresponding o-aminothiols. Desulphonation of 23 afforded the pyrazolotriazine 24. Finally, reaction of 2 with 2-hydroxybenzaldehyde gave benzofuran derivative 25. Representative compounds of the synthesized products were evaluated as antioxidant agents.

Abstract: A new class of N-basic side chains was obtained from 2,3-dihydro-2H-3-oxobenzo[d]isothiazole and aliphatic or aromatic aldehydes. Secondary amines (morpholine, N-methylpiperazine and ethyl isonipecotate) afforded tertiary N-basic side chains (4–6), while dibasic secondary amines (such as piperazine) gave bis-tertiary N-basic side chains (2). On the other hand, the use of mono- or dibasic primary amines namely; aniline, anisidine, phenyl hydrazine, o-hydroxy benzoic acid hydrazide, hydrazine hydrate, and ethylenediamine (instead of secondary amines) afforded secondary N-basic side chain as mono component or as bis component 7a-c, 9a-c, 11 and 12a-c. In addition, secondary Mannich base was synthesized via Michael addition to the corresponding aldimine. The new compounds were investigated for antioxidant and antimicrobial activities. Compounds 2, 7c and 12a exhibited significant antimicrobial activity, whereas compounds 7a, 7b, 9b, 9c and 11 exhibited high antioxidant activity as compared to ascorbic acid, These compounds showed the best protective effect against DNA damage induced by bleomycin.

Abstract: Cyclododecanone is a highly important synthetic intermediate for macrocyclic systems. This review is the sole and comprehensive one that covers the different aspects of cyclododecanone chemistry over the period from 1950 to 2010.

Abstract: Quinuclidin-3-one ( 1 ) was used as a versatile intermediate for the synthesis of fused and spiro quinuclidine and its C -nucleosides. The reaction of 1 with formalin and secondary amines namely; morpholine, piperidine, and piperazine afforded the corresponding Mannich bases 2 - 4 in acid medium. Quinuclidino[3,2- b ]pyran 5 has been synthesized via a selective cyclocondensation reaction between Mannich base of quinuclidinone hydrochloride 2 and malononitrile. The transformation of 1 with formalin and methylamine in molar ratio (1:20:2) afforded the spiro compound 7 . Ring expansion of 2 under Schmidt reaction conditions gave the 1,3-diazabicyclo[3.2.2]nonanone derivative 6 . Eventually, the synthesis of C -nucleosides 10 , 12 - 14 were achieved by using aldohexoses and aldopentose catalyzed by zinc chloride, while, the bis -quinuclidine derivative 15 was obtained by using sodium carbonate. Newly synthesized compounds were characterized by IR, 1 H NMR, and mass spectral data.
